Dough mixers are designed to handle large quantities of dough, saving time and manual effort compared to hand mixing. They ensure uniform mixing and kneading, resulting in consistent dough texture and gluten development. These machines offer variable speed settings, allowing adjustments according to different recipes and dough types. Equipped with powerful motors, they can handle heavy dough and provide thorough mixing.
There are several types of dough mixers available, each suited for different types of dough:
- Spiral Mixers: Ideal for heavy dough, such as bread dough, as they provide excellent gluten development.
- Planetary Mixers: Versatile and can handle a variety of dough types.
- Fork Mixers: Suitable for softer dough, such as pastry dough.

Biscuit production lines typically involve several stages, including material dosing, dough mixing, forming, baking, cooling, and packaging. For hard dough biscuits, vertical dough mixers are often used, while soft dough biscuits may use horizontal mixers.
Cookie production lines also rely heavily on dough mixers for uniform dough preparation. These lines often include stages such as dough mixing, forming, baking, and packaging. The type of mixer used can affect the texture and consistency of the final product.
The cost of dough mixers varies widely based on their type, capacity, and intended use. For home bakers or small-scale producers, mixers can range from a few hundred to a few thousand dollars. However, for commercial or industrial use, the cost can be significantly higher, often exceeding tens of thousands of dollars.
- Capacity: Larger mixers with higher capacities are more expensive.
- Type: Spiral mixers are generally more expensive than planetary or fork mixers.
- Brand and Quality: Premium brands and high-quality components increase the cost.
- Features: Additional features like multiple speed settings and advanced control systems can also impact the price.

Proper maintenance is crucial to extend the lifespan of dough mixers and ensure optimal performance. Regular cleaning, lubrication of moving parts, and timely replacement of worn components are essential tasks. Additionally, training staff on proper usage and troubleshooting can help prevent unnecessary downtime.
- Regular Cleaning: Clean the mixer after each use to prevent dough buildup.
- Lubrication: Regularly lubricate moving parts to reduce wear.
- Inspection: Regularly inspect the mixer for signs of wear or damage.
